A Foodie's Guide to Bucharest

Bucharest, the vibrant capital of Romania, is a feast for the senses, particularly for foodies. Beyond its historical landmarks and charming cobblestone streets, this city boasts an eclectic read more culinary scene that seamlessly blends traditional Romanian dishes with modern European influences. From hearty stews to delectable pastries, Bucharest has something to tantalize every palate.

A must-try for any visitor is the iconic "mici," small grilled sausages served with mustard and a side of cornmeal porridge. For a taste of Romanian comfort food, indulge in "sarmale," cabbage rolls stuffed with minced meat and rice. And don't forget to sample the mouthwatering "cozonac," a sweet braided bread often enjoyed during holidays.

Bucharest's trendy restaurant scene is constantly evolving, with creative eateries popping up all the time. Explore the charming neighborhoods of Lipscani and Old Town for a diverse range of dining options, from charming traditional restaurants to elegant fine-dining establishments.

  • Savor in a meal at Caru' cu Bere, a historic restaurant renowned for its traditional Romanian cuisine and lively atmosphere.
